| 70 of 70 people found the following review helpful This review is from: Samsung S2 USB 2.0 1TB Ultraslim Portable Hard Drive - Black (Accessory) A great little device, the 1TB size means i have tried my hardest but so far have not filled it, even though it stores all of my music, photo's, movies etc etc etc. Comes with a small black slip-on case in the box, so i went with the cheaper black model over twice the price crazy colours since you only ever see the case anyway! Makes no noise at all, and has a small blue light that eminates from the top front when it's plugged in. Requires no additional power supply other than the single USB cable it comes with(approx 30cm long), so can plug into any USB 2.0 port to function. Tried with my old computer that uses USB 1.0 to extract all of my files to transfer onto my new pc and it still runs, but runs even slower than USB 1.0 should, i mean very very slow, but was the only way to get all of my old files off of it.When you plug in for the first time you need to wait for your pc to auto detect install (same as any portable USB device), and after that you will have to...
